Output af512aaad06ddb7ff0d4f66d1d99c89c59fd963c85736d0ef9e54d56852ac142:0

value
21036300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fefb37cf02a026830c1c13d6b45f6990267ac7f1 OP_EQUAL
address
3QwEWCe6Knjmpj86yC8PZ5ah37yGDPUdjj
transaction
af512aaad06ddb7ff0d4f66d1d99c89c59fd963c85736d0ef9e54d56852ac142
spent
true